    Must-have skills and qualifications

    •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ree, preferably in Computer Science or a related field, with 8+ years of experience in IT.
    • Proven expertise in Digital Workplace architecture, including Microsoft 365, VMware Workspace One, Citrix, and ServiceNow.
    • Knowledge of enterprise architecture frameworks, such as TOGAF and ZACHMAN.
    • Experience working within agile methodologies, like Scrum and SAFe.
    • Demonstrable experience defining and implementing innovative workplace solutions.
    • Fluent in English and minimum B1/B2 level Dutch, with strong communication skills to represent the company as a thought leader.

    Nice-to-have’s:

    • Experience in telecom, internet or similar industries.
    • Familiarity with advanced knowledge management systems and digital transformation.
    • Industry-recognized certifications (e.g., MCSA, VCP-DW) are a plus.
